HISTORY HAPPENED HERE at Bald Prairie Church of Christ
Organized in 1847, this fellowship worshiped with members of the Baptist church until the groups separated in 1849. A log structure served the 15 charter members of this congregation as a church and school. Elijah Rains (1813-1889) donated land for the church and community cemetery. The present building, erected during the 1880s, doubled as a school for over 20 years. It also served as a funeral chapel and social and cultural center for the community. The classrooms were added in 1940. Descendants of early members still worship here. Source: https://atlas.thc.texas.gov/Details/5395010901
